Delve into the heart of medieval literature with "Song & Legend From the Middle Ages," a collection illuminating the ballads, folk songs, and traditions of the era. Authored by William D. McClintock and Porter Lander McClintock, this volume offers both a selection of medieval verse and insightful literary criticism.
Explore themes of chivalry and adventure prevalent in the songs and stories of the Middle Ages. This carefully curated work examines the historical and cultural context of these enduring pieces, providing a deeper understanding of their significance. Discover the rich tapestry of medieval life as reflected in its music and poetry. "Song & Legend From the Middle Ages" provides a vital window into a pivotal period in European history, offering enduring insights into the literary landscape of the time.
